Frequently Asked Questions about Bal Harbour
How much are Studio apartments in Bal Harbour?
There are currently 85 Studio Apartments in Bal Harbour with rent ranges from $1,250 to $4,000 with an average price of $1,825.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bal Harbour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bal Harbour ranges from $1,500 to $7,800 with an average monthly rent of $2,380.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bal Harbour c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bal Harbour range from $1,950 to $16,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,389.
How expensive are Bal Harbour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 52 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bal Harbour on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,500 to $13,500 - averaging $7,041 for the location.
